Des starring David Tennant from ITV has been internationally sold

The British drama series Des, which features David Tennant (Broadchurch) in the lead role has sold its international distribution rights to various streaming services and networks.
In Des, David Tennant (Broadchurch) can be seen as the British serial killer Dennis Nilsen. The series shows Nilsen from the moment of his arrest till his trial and is based on the book Killing For Company from Brian Masters. Luke Neal wrote the first two episodes and Lewis Arnold the third. Next to Tennant, the cast further consists of Jason Watkins (The Crown) and Daniel Mays (Line of Duty).

The ITV miniseries has been taken over by C More Entertainment in Denmark, Finland, Norway and Sweden. The Belgian VRT, the Icelandic Siminn hf, the Nordic TV2 and the Irish Virgin Media Television have bought the distribution rights. In the United States, Canada and the Caribbean, the series has been taken over by Sundance Now from AMC Networks. In Latin America, DIRECTV has taken over, in Australia STAN and in New-Zealand TVNZ.
